Description
The experts at Bruun Rasmussen informed us that this was a study for Ilsted's En italiensk gårdhave (An italian court garden). That painting was sold at Arne Bruun Rasmussen auction 522 in 1989. The staircase also featured in one of Ilsted's mezzotints (see "other versions").
